After being called up to the Twins last week, outfielder Aaron Hicks has seven hits in seven games. The seventh came during the eighth inning of Tuesday night's 8-5 win over the Pirates, when reliever Jared Hughes seemed to have momentarily hallucinated that he was playing soccer.
Nabbing the speedy Hicks at first would've been a tough play regardless for Hughes, but accidentally sending the ball flying into foul territory with his toe certainly did him no favors. Just look at the agony on his face:
Hey, at least catcher Chris Stewart played a bit of goalie and reached the ball in time to keep Hicks from rounding toward second.
